2. Manually Install "r-qusage" via AUR

a. Ensure you have the base development tools and git installed with:

$ sudo pacman -S --needed base-devel git

b. Clone r-qusage's git locally

$ git clone https://aur.archlinux.org/r-qusage.git ~/r-qusage

c. Go to ~/r-qusage folder and install it

$ cd ~/r-qusage $ makepkg -si
